Adobe Researchers AI CLIPS open source image subtitles

ClipS is an imagecaptioning AI model that produces finegrained descriptions of images. In assessments with captions generated by other models, human j

ClipS is an imagecaptioning AI model that produces finegrained descriptions of images. In assessments with captions generated by other models, human judges most often preferred those generated by CLIPS. The team also developed a new reference dataset, FineCapEval. Researchers have developed a novel way to finetune the textencoder portion of CLIP. They also introduced a twolayer classifier head that detects whether a sentence is grammatically correct. Egypts First LRT Electric Project A final success in exporting Chinese railway technology to Africa

Egypts first electrified light rail transit LRT system started trial runs on Sunday, with Egyptian President AbdelFattah alSisi taking the first ride.

Egypts first electrified light rail transit LRT system started trial runs on Sunday, with Egyptian President AbdelFattah alSisi taking the first ride. $ 1.24 billion LRT provides efficient transportation for 5 million inhabitants. It is the latest of a string of mega infrastructure projects Chinese companies delivered to their customers in the past week. The project is the latest Chinese railway project in Africa, following other signature projects such as the MombasaNairobi Standard Gauge Railway. China has spent years building infrastructure in African countries, and investment in African countries outstrips that of most Western countries and the International Monetary Fund. Railway systems manufactured in China are appreciated by African countries for their high efficiency and low cost. Read More..

More than half of new car buyers are interested in electric vehicles

More than half of potential car buyers are considering the purchase of an electric vehicle, according to research from Roland Berger. However, this is

More than half of potential car buyers are considering the purchase of an electric vehicle, according to research from Roland Berger. However, this is still proving slow to translate into demand, with fewer than oneinten global customers ultimately plumping for an electric option. Around 69% of one poll said they would expect to merely refer to cars when speaking about electric vehicles in 10 years. Norway is far and away from the biggest market for EVs on this basis, with sold units rising from 61.8% of the nations car market in 2020 to 76.4% in 2022. Meanwhile, Brazil, India, Thailand, Russia, Indonesia, and Saudi Arabia all saw EV sales languishing at beneath 1%.
